Swedish hosting provider Loopia used by Greenpeace locked critical network address Nestespoil.com wich is against Neste Oils bio-diesel production. Address is now presented with a big stop sign and the swedish language explanation.
Explanation is that the account has been frozen and the owner is requested to contact the Loopia.
The Greenpeace did, according to program director Tapio Laakso Loopia at least not at present agree to pass the address to another service provider. A domain name is locked. So Greenpeace can not get the address activities, for example by changing the service provider.
- This is a big concern about internet network freedom of speech , Laakso says. According to him, even if the matter can be compared to a newspaper, which is left without pressing because of its content may be offensive to some.
Neste Oil has appealed to WIPO, of which a decision is expected around mid-summer 2012. Laakso believes Loopian to have the same letters, which the oil company sent to Wipo. Greenpeace believes that Loopia acted hastily.
Greenpeace has transferred the contents of the address Nestespoil.com to www.greenpeace.fi/nestespoilcom.
